Topics in Urban Imaginaries in Literature and Film

GRS LF 641

  • Aesthetic Exploration
  • The Individual in Community
  • Creativity/Innovation

Students examine the filmic and literary representations of urban environments in France and the francophone world; the phenomenon of urbanization, the historical development, cultural and artistic context of its attractive power; fluxes of migration of the city; streets and monuments as characters. Effective Fall 2021, this course fulfills a single unit in each of the following BU Hub areas: The Individual in Community, Aesthetic Exploration, Creativity/Innovation.
